About

Michelle Peterson is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cell Biology and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Michelle Peterson has authored 33 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Cell Biology and 7 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Michelle Peterson’s work include Cellular Mechanics and Interactions (6 papers), Traumatic Brain Injury Research (5 papers) and Peptidase Inhibition and Analysis (5 papers). Michelle Peterson is often cited by papers focused on Cellular Mechanics and Interactions (6 papers), Traumatic Brain Injury Research (5 papers) and Peptidase Inhibition and Analysis (5 papers). Michelle Peterson collaborates with scholars based in United States, Israel and Canada. Michelle Peterson's co-authors include Mark S. Mooseker, Margaret A. Titus, Kristine Novak, Mary C. Reedy, William M. Bement, Steven Scott, David X. Cifu, Bruce R. Stevenson, Jayakumar R. Nair and Peter Novick and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Cell Biology, Journal of Cell Science and PLoS Genetics.
